He's lost his words. She's losing her patience. And now... they've got company.

Charlie Kittredge is a bestselling novelist with a problem-he can't write a single word. As his deadline looms, so does the strain on his relationship with Margaret, the woman he loves but may be slowly losing.

Margaret has her own challenges-starting with her unpredictable mother, Gwendolyn, whose flair for drama leaves chaos in her wake. And then there's Sunny, their loyal friend, whose life is unraveling faster than she can hold it together.

When Gwendolyn is unavoidably stranded in Los Angeles and Sunny is suddenly homeless, both women land on Charlie and Margaret's doorstep... and don't leave.

What begins as a temporary arrangement quickly spirals into emotional upheaval, clashing personalities, and long-buried secrets. At a disastrous family gathering, everything comes to a head-and the fallout threatens to tear them all apart.

Now, separated and searching for answers, each must confront their past, their choices, and what truly matters in midlife and beyond... before it's too late to make things right.

By turns witty, heartfelt, and deeply human, The Unexpected Guests is a page-turning celebration of love, second chances, and the complicated ties that bind us.
